Sheraton Revival Writing desk, inlaid mahogany


A very pretty inlaid mahogany Sheraton Revival writing table.
This has a most unusual sliding top that when pulled forward reveals a lifting letter rack. All in great condition with the original cabinet antique furniture and what seems to be the original leather. A few reassuring scuffs but not ripped or anything. The gold tooling is clear and of good detailing and the insides are clean. A lovely example with the inlays and the fretted back rail and the cross stretcher between the legs.
A rather nice piece of English furniture from the Edwardian period, not repeatable we suggest. We have been in business for 40 years and are now coming up to retirement.
